The Importance of Minimal Viable Products (MVPs)
A key component of vincispin is the development of Minimal Viable Products (MVPs). An MVP isn't a half-finished product; it’s a version of your offering with just enough features to attract early-adopter customers and validate a product idea early in the development cycle. The purpose of an MVP is to gather validated learning about customer behavior and preferences, not to achieve perfection. Building an MVP allows you to test your core assumptions without investing significant resources into a full-fledged product that might ultimately fail to meet market demands. By focusing on the essential features, you can quickly and efficiently gather feedback and iterate on your design. It’s a cost-effective way to reduce risk and increase the likelihood of building a successful product.
| Experiment Type | Goal | Key Metrics | Example |
|---|---|---|---|
| A/B Testing | Compare two versions of a feature | Conversion Rate, Click-Through Rate | Testing different call-to-action buttons on a landing page |
| Landing Page Test | Validate interest in a product concept | Sign-up Rate, Email Capture | Creating a simple landing page to gauge interest in a new service |
| Concierge MVP | Manually deliver a service to test demand | Customer Satisfaction, Repeat Usage | Providing a personalized service to a small group of customers |
| Wizard of Oz MVP | Simulate functionality to test user behavior | Task Completion Rate, User Feedback | Appearing to have automated a process when it’s actually being done manually |
The table above highlights some typical experiment types used within a vincispin framework. Selecting the right experiment type is crucial for gathering meaningful data and validating assumptions effectively. Each experiment should be designed with clear objectives and measurable outcomes.

Tools and Technologies for Vincispin Implementation
Several tools and technologies can facilitate the implementation of vincispin. A/B testing platforms like Optimizely and VWO allow you to easily test different variations of website pages and landing pages. Analytics tools like Google Analytics provide valuable insights into user behavior and help you track key metrics. Project management tools like Asana and Trello can help you organize your experiments and track progress. Customer feedback platforms like SurveyMonkey and Typeform allow you to gather insights directly from your customers. Data visualization tools like Tableau and Power BI enable you to present your findings in a clear and compelling manner. Choosing the right tools depends on the specific needs of your organization and the types of experiments you're conducting.
